An informal contract is an agreement, orally or written, usually of a simple nature. Informal contracts, also known as informal agreements, can be legally binding, but it is much harder to enforce these in court.

Informal Quotation means a request for prices on specific goods and/or services obtained informally from selected sources, which may or may not be submitted verbally, in writing, electronically or transmitted by facsimile; View Source. Based on 7 documents.
There are five main elements when forming an informal contract: Mutual assent. Consideration or validation. Two or more parties entering a contract. Parties have to have legal rights to contract. No statute or rules declaring a contract void.
Quote: An offer by a contractor for the sale of a good or service. An informal quote can be verbal (received by phone and documented in the requisition) or written. A formal quote must be received in writing from the contractor.

An Informal Quotation Contract is a non-binding agreement where a vendor provides a price estimate for goods or services based on specific requirements without the need for a formal bidding process.
Typically, businesses or organizations that are procuring goods or services and wish to secure a quote from a vendor or supplier may be required to file an Informal Quotation Contract.
To fill out an Informal Quotation Contract, one should include the requester's information, vendor details, item descriptions, quantities, prices, terms and conditions, and the signature of both parties to confirm agreement.
The purpose of an Informal Quotation Contract is to obtain pricing and terms from potential suppliers efficiently without the complexity and formality of a formal contract or bidding process.
The information that must be reported on an Informal Quotation Contract typically includes the names and addresses of the parties involved, item descriptions, quantities, unit prices, total cost, delivery terms, and the deadline for acceptance.
